This position is located in the Office of Finance and Operations, Office of Budget Service, Budget Execution and Administrative Analysis Division (BEAAD), Administrative Analysis Branch (AAB). The AAB is responsible for budget formulation and execution activities for all of the Department's administrative accounts. The Branch monitors and analyzes Full-time equivalent (FTE) usage and performs workload data analysis in working to best align FTE resources with areas of high Department priority.

Qualifications:

To qualify for the GS-15: You must have one year of Specialized Experience equivalent to the next lower grade level (GS-14 or equivalent) in the federal service that has equipped you with the particular knowledge, skills and abilities to perform successfully the duties of the position, and that is typically in or related to the work of the position.

1. Experience coordinating the formulation, review, analysis, development, presentation, and/or execution of administrative budgets;

2. Experience implementing planning and budget guidance from the Office of Management and Budget; and

3. Experience analyzing impacts of legislative or programmatic changes on budget systems and policies.

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ities (KSAs)

The quality of your experience will be measured by the extent to which you possess the following knowledge, skills and abilities (KSAs). You do not need to provide separate narrative responses to these KSAs, as they will be measured by your responses to the occupational questionnaire (you may preview the occupational questionnaire by clicking the link at the end of the Evaluations section of this vacancy announcement).

1. Knowledge of all phases of administrative budgeting, the budget process, and all associated procedures and regulations.

2. Skill in analysis and comparison of cost benefit of alternative budget and program actions.

3. Ability to analyze budgetary and operational regulations, legislation and policies.

As a Supervisory Budget Analyst, GS-0560-15, you will be responsible for:

  • Advising the Budget Execution and Administrative Analysis Division's (BEAAD) Director and leading and managing the day-to-day activities of staff including formulation and execution activities for all of the Department's administrative accounts.
  • Providing accurate and timely support on identifying issues and undertaking special analyses with respect to budget problems such as resource allocation.
  • Providing advice on budgetary policy changes, defining emerging problems in the agency's planning and budget process.
  • Developing and issuing instructions and time schedules to principle offices for the annual submission of administrative budget requests and justifications; and reviewing and analyzing planning and budget submissions for conformance to established agency policy issues.
  • Maintaining continuing liaison with and representing the BEAAD Director in meetings with the agency as well as The Office of Management and Budget (OMB), Congressional staff, and the General Accounting Office.
  • Preparing OMB and Congressional justification budget materials.
  • Developing cost-benefit analyses of budgetary requests.
  • Interpreting the impact of major changes in the agency’s programs on budgetary systems and policies.
  • Adhering to agency policies in performing all or most of the following supervisory functions:  Responsibility to agency management for the quantity and quality of work done and for assuring efficient and economical work operations; responsibility for planning, organizing, assigning, and reviewing work and administering personnel matters.
